I prefer mixed blends of pellets. The mix of hardwood (oak,hickory) with fruit woods make for a nice flavor profile.

I think straight Hickory might be a bit too much of a good thing. I really don't burn much hickory (pellets or splits) these days.

You can also mix your own pellets if you prefer.
